An Overview of the DEIF iE 250


The DEIF iE 250 is a robust, flexible, and secure smart energy controller for next-generation ship power systems. It is essentially used to control, protect, and optimize a network of electrical equipment on board, e.g., generators, hybrid power plants, and shore power connections.
One of its strongest points is its modular hardware platform. The same controller can be configured for various vessel types without altering the underlying system. Such flexibility enables shipbuilders, designers, and operators to employ one controller in various configurations by adding, replacing, or adding on plug-in modules.

- Modular and Customizable Architecture
The iE 250 features a highly modular architecture through which users can readily plug in input modules, output modules, or measurement modules, or even external I/O racks for advanced systems.
That makes it possible for one controller to serve from small genset applications to large hybrid applications. When operational needs evolve, modules can be replaced or upgraded with no significant reconfiguration.

- Intuitive Interface for Smooth Operation
Ease of use and rapid viewability are critical in marine operations. The 7-inch color touchscreen on the iE 250 delivers operators a clean and intuitive view of power performance. It is operable by touchscreen, navigation keys, or buttons, whichever is most convenient for the operator.
With DEIF’s PICUS software, engineers can tailor dashboards using a straightforward drag-and-drop interface so that only the most information-rich data appears. - Large Processing Capacity for Sophisticated Operations
At the heart is a quad-core CPU with the capacity to handle heavy control applications and synchronize several controllers on one busbar in real time.
For specialist applications, DEIF’s CustomLogic™ and CODESYS options enable customers to develop application-specific control logic according to specific vessel demands.

- Cybersecurity and Compliance
Cybersecurity is as critical today in the globalized maritime environment as physical safety is. The iE 250 is IACS UR E27 certified and assured to be fully compliant with the latest international norms of cyber resistance for maritime systems.
Such certification protects ships from cyberattacks and from non-conformity with the IACS E26 rules applicable to all newbuild vessels from July 2024.

- Multiple Mounting and Installation Options
There’s a specific design for each vessel, and DEIF has made sure that the iE 250 will find it easy to fit into various configurations. The iE 250 provides several installation choices:
- Front-mounted: Display and controller in a single unit.
- Base-mounted with remote display: Suitable for complicated wiring schemes.
- Base-mounted local: Controller and display side by side for ease of use.

- High Input and Output Capability
The iE 250 can accommodate direct plug-in I/O modules with bidirectional digital and analog channels and can also be connected to external racks like the iE 650 series for expansion.
Its intelligent terminal configuration enables the selection of channels for different applications, digital inputs, analog load sharing, or accurate measurement functions.

- Smart Access, Event Logging, and Shortcuts
The controller stores up to 2,000 event logs, so operation history is readily available to analyze or troubleshoot.
In addition, programmable shortcut keys provide instant access to frequently used functions to streamline operations and minimize response times.

Applications Across Marine Engineering
The DEIF iE 250 is poised to address real-world applications encountered by marine engineers and shipmasters. Its flexibility allows it to perform multiple energy control tasks, including:
Genset Control and Protection: Provides secure, efficient operation of the generators and automatic synchronization to aid in continuous power.
Power Management Systems (PMS): Synchronizes and controls a maximum of 32 gensets for oceangoing or commercial ships.
Hybrid and Electric Power Systems: Synchronize renewable and battery-based power to conserve fuel consumption and emissions.
Shore Connection Management: Provides stable power during docking, minimizing fuel consumption and pollution.
Shaft and Emergency Generator Control: Controls sophisticated logic for standby and emergency power systems.
